Output 95a1254aef53d56ebf2717f56822b1669c85b5b85c9c5f65c4e22c00fd623632:58

value
250000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f945df56228a271c9544277c4b947497acb2b9c OP_EQUALVERIFY OP_CHECKSIG
address
1JTyoMxJNXMyNjrDEdXVJ3zitfLmN2JJXd
transaction
95a1254aef53d56ebf2717f56822b1669c85b5b85c9c5f65c4e22c00fd623632
spent
true